Understanding the Australian Government's Support for Tree Planting

The Australian government has long recognized the importance of tree planting in creating a sustainable and greener future. As such, it has implemented various initiatives and support programs to encourage and facilitate tree planting activities across the country. These programs aim to address environmental concerns, such as deforestation, habitat loss, and climate change, while also promoting the numerous benefits that trees provide to communities and ecosystems.

One prominent initiative is the Tree Planting Grant Program, which provides financial assistance to individuals, organizations, and communities that wish to undertake tree planting projects. This program offers funding opportunities for a wide range of tree planting initiatives, including reforestation, urban greening, land rehabilitation, and biodiversity conservation. By providing grants, the government aims to support and incentivize projects that contribute to the overall goal of increasing tree cover and enhancing the natural environment.

Eligibility Criteria for the Tree Planting Grant in Australia
To ensure that the Tree Planting Grant reaches the right beneficiaries, there are specific eligibility criteria set by the Australian government. Firstly, the grant is available to individuals, organizations, and communities across the country who are committed to undertaking tree planting initiatives. Eligible applicants must be Australian citizens, permanent residents, or registered entities operating within the country.

Furthermore, the proposed tree planting projects must align with the environmental objectives set by the government. This includes projects that aim to restore degraded landscapes, enhance biodiversity, and contribute to climate change mitigation efforts. Additionally, applicants must provide a detailed plan outlining the number of trees to be planted, the species selected, and the location of the project.

Lastly, applicants need to demonstrate their ability to successfully implement and manage the proposed tree planting project. This may include providing evidence of past experience, relevant qualifications, or partnerships with other organizations or stakeholders. By ensuring that the grant is awarded to capable and committed individuals or groups, the Australian government aims to maximize the impact of tree planting initiatives and achieve the desired environmental outcomes.
